Silver scandium is a binary inorganic compound of scandium and silver with the formula AgSc, crystals.

Physical Properties
Silver scandium forms crystals of cubic syngony , space group P m3m , cell parameters a = 0.3412 nm , Z = 1 , structure of the type of cesium chloride CsCl [1] [2] [3] [4] .
The compound melts congruently at a temperature of 1155 ° C.
